The AD629BR-REEL7 is a high precision, low power, differential amplifier designed by the renowned Analog Devices Inc., which specializes in delivering superior performance for instrumentation and sensor interfaces. This component stands out for its ability to accurately amplify small differential signals in the presence of large common-mode voltages, making it an ideal choice for a wide array of applications including industrial, medical, and consumer electronics.
Key Features
- High Common-Mode Rejection Ratio (CMRR): The AD629BR-REEL7 boasts an impressive CMRR of 86 dB (min) at 60 Hz, which ensures accurate readings in environments with significant electrical noise.
- Wide Power Supply Range: This differential amplifier operates on a supply voltage range from ±2.3 V to ±18 V, providing versatility in various system designs.
- Single-Ended or Differential Output: The device can be configured to provide either a single-ended or differential output, enhancing its adaptability to different circuit topologies.
- Low Quiescent Current: With a typical quiescent current of just 1.1 mA, the AD629BR-REEL7 is suitable for battery-powered devices where power efficiency is crucial.
- Robust Input Voltage Range: It can handle a wide input voltage range, allowing it to process signals with large common-mode voltages without saturation.
